Key Skills You Will Master
✓ Data Cleaning and Preparation – You will develop the ability to transform raw data into a usable format because effective analysis relies on high-quality data, increasing your marketability to employers.
✓ Statistical Analysis – You will be equipped to derive meaningful insights from data sets, as statistical literacy is foundational in making data-driven decisions, thereby enhancing your decision-making skills in various industries.
✓ Data Visualization with Tools like Tableau or Power BI – You will learn to create compelling visual presentations of data findings, which is crucial in communicating insights to stakeholders and unlocking new job opportunities in both technical and non-technical roles.
✓ SQL for Data Management – You will acquire skills to query and manipulate databases, as SQL is a key tool for accessing and analyzing data, significantly boosting your earning potential in data-centric positions.
✓ Basic Understanding of Machine Learning Concepts – You will gain insights into predictive analytics, which is increasingly relevant as organizations look to harness data for future planning, making you a valuable asset in any data team.
